Cream Cheese Brownies: The Perfect Blend of Richness and Creaminess!

Cream cheese brownies offer a delightful twist on the classic brownie. By incorporating a creamy layer of cream cheese, these brownies achieve a unique blend of fudgy richness and tangy sweetness. With their appealing marbled appearance and satisfying texture, cream cheese brownies have gained popularity among dessert lovers around the world.

Origin and Popularity of Brownies

Brownies are believed to have originated in the United States in the late 19th century. Their exact origin remains a subject of debate among culinary historians. However, it is widely accepted that brownies emerged as a result of the desire for a portable chocolate dessert that could be eaten without the need for utensils.

Over time, brownies have evolved, with numerous variations introduced. The introduction of cream cheese into the brownie mix adds a new dynamic to the traditional recipe, enhancing both flavor and texture.

The Role of Cream Cheese

Cream cheese acts as the perfect complement to the rich chocolate flavors of brownies. It contributes a creamy, smooth texture that balances the density of the brownie base. The mildly tart flavor of cream cheese cuts through the sweetness of chocolate, creating a harmonious combination.

Adding cream cheese not only enhances the flavor profile but also introduces moisture to the brownies, ensuring they remain fudgy and rich. This results in a decadent treat that appeals to a wide range of palates.

Culinary Techniques for Perfect Brownies

Achieving the perfect cream cheese brownie requires careful attention to the baking process. Here are some important culinary techniques to consider:

  • Ingredient Temperature: Ensure that both the cream cheese and the eggs are at room temperature. This allows for better incorporation and creaminess.
  • Swirling Technique: After pouring the brownie batter into the pan, dollop the cream cheese mixture on top and use a knife or a skewer to create a marbled effect. This technique not only enhances the visual appeal but also ensures an even distribution of flavors.
  • Baking Time: To avoid over-baking, it is crucial to keep an eye on the brownies as they cook. Testing with a toothpick should yield some moist crumbs without being wet.
  • Cooling Period: Allow the brownies to cool completely in the pan before cutting. This helps set the cream cheese layer and makes it easier to achieve clean cuts.

Variations of Cream Cheese Brownies

The versatility of cream cheese brownies allows for various adaptations and flavors. Some popular variations include:

  • Swirling Additional Flavors: Other flavorings like peanut butter, caramel, or fruit purees can be swirled into the cream cheese for extra richness.
  • Incorporating Chocolate Chips: Adding chocolate chips to the brownie batter can enhance the chocolate flavor and add an enjoyable texture.
  • Nutty Twist: Chopped nuts like walnuts or pecans can be added for crunch and additional flavor complexity.
  • Gluten-Free Options: For those with gluten sensitivities, almond flour or gluten-free flour blends can be used to create a gluten-free version of cream cheese brownies.

Cream Cheese Brownies

Yield: 12 Servings
Prep Time: 20 minutes
Cook Time: 33 minutes
Total Time: 53 minutes

Ingredients

  • **Brownie batter:
  • ½ cup unsalted butter, melted, still warm/hot
  • 1 cup granulated sugar
  • 2 large eggs
  • 1 tablespoon water
  • 2 teaspoons pure vanilla extract
  • ⅔ cup unsweetened cocoa powder
  • ¾ cup plus 1 tablespoon all purpose flour, see note
  • ½ teaspoon kosher salt
  • ½ cup chocolate chips
  • **Cream cheese mixture:
  • 8 oz block cream cheese, softened
  • ½ cup granulated sugar
  • 1 tablespoon all purpose flour
  • 1 large egg white
  • ½ teaspoon pure vanilla extract

Instructions

Preheat the oven to 350°F.

  1. Position a rack in the center.
  2. Line an 8×8 pan with foil or parchment, leaving overhang on two sides.
  3. Grease the lined pan.

Prepare the brownie batter.

  1. In a large bowl, combine granulated sugar and hot butter.
  2. Stir briefly and let sit for 5 minutes to help dissolve the sugar.
  3. After 5 minutes, whisk vigorously for 30 seconds.
  4. Add eggs, water, and vanilla extract, whisking for 30 seconds.
  5. Tap excess batter off the whisk and set it aside.

Combine dry ingredients.

  1. Sprinkle cocoa powder, flour, and salt over the wet mixture.
  2. Use a rubber spatula to stir until glossy and well combined.

Reserve part of the batter and add chocolate chips.

  1. Scoop out about one third of the brownie mixture and set it aside.
  2. Mix chocolate chips into the remaining batter.

Prepare the baking pan.

  1. Spread the brownie batter into the lined pan in an even layer.

Create the cream cheese mixture.

  1. Using a mixer, beat cream cheese until smooth.
  2. Add sugar, flour, egg white, and vanilla, beating until combined.
  3. Scrape the bowl as necessary to avoid overbeating.

Assemble the swirls.

  1. Use two tablespoons to alternate dropping portions of cream cheese and reserved brownie batter on top of the batter in the pan.
  2. Swirl together using a sharp knife in a figure 8 or back and forth motion, being careful not to swirl too deep.

Bake the brownies.

  1. Bake for 32-37 minutes until mostly set with a slight jiggle in the cream cheese areas.
  2. Use a toothpick to check doneness; moist fudgy crumbs are acceptable.
  3. If cream cheese swirls darken, loosely cover with foil for the last 5 minutes.

Cool the brownies.

  1. Remove from the oven and transfer to a cooling rack.
  2. Allow to cool completely, which may take several hours.
